Probable cause
FAILURE OF THE PILOT-IN-COMMAND TO FOLLOW THE CHECKLIST AND COMPLACENCY OF THE PILOT-IN-COMMAND FOR FAILURE TO EXTEND THE LANDING GEAR BEFORE LANDING.
